How to "Lean In" to Your Business Without Sacrificing Your Relationships or Family

There’s been a lot of buzz about Sheryl Sandberg’s book, Lean In. In the book , she deals with the lack of women in positions of leadership in business and across the board. In this workshop, we plan to teach women to how to lean into their business without sacrificing their relationships or their families. Many of us want the business and the family, but too few people are teaching how to navigate this successfully. We hope to teach participants how to: 1. Define what success looks like for their business and their family. 2. Create a support network for their success in both. 3. Set parameters/boundaries around business and family 4. Discuss expectations and how to manage them on a regular basis and renegotiate them when needed. 5. Create a plan of preparation/ prevention versus recovery / rescue for their business and family.
